Visa & Entry

British passport holders enter the US under the Visa Waiver Program (VWP) for up to 90 days for tourism or business. You must obtain an ESTA (Electronic System for Travel Authorization) before departure. The ESTA costs $21, is valid for 2 years or until your passport expires, and allows multiple entries. Apply at esta.cbp.dhs.gov, the only official site. Most approvals come within minutes, but apply at least 72 hours before travel. The 90-day stay cannot be extended under the VWP.

Passport must be an electronic/biometric passport (all UK passports issued since 2006 qualify). You need proof of onward travel out of the US within 90 days. CBP officers at the port of entry make the final admission decision and can ask about trip purpose, accommodation, and ties to the UK. Automated passport control (APC) kiosks and Global Entry (for pre-approved travelers) speed up arrival processing. Anyone with certain criminal convictions, prior visa denials, or dual nationality with Iran, Iraq, Libya, North Korea, Somalia, Sudan, Syria, or Yemen may be ineligible for the VWP and need a B-1/B-2 visa ($185) from the US Embassy in London.

The 90-day VWP clock does not reset by visiting Canada, Mexico, or the Caribbean and returning to the US; the original 90 days continues to count down. No vaccination requirements for UK arrivals. US Customs allows $800 worth of goods duty-free per person.

Getting from PHL

SEPTA Airport Line from the terminal to Center City takes 25–30 minutes ($8). Trains run every 30 minutes (5am to midnight) to 30th Street, Suburban, and Jefferson stations; all with connections to the subway and regional rail network. Buy tickets at platform machines.Taxis to Center City cost $28–35 (flat rate). Ride-shares to Center City run $22–35. For New York City, the Bolt Bus and Greyhound stop near 30th Street Station, or take NJ Transit to New York Penn Station (connecting from 30th Street). Amtrak also departs 30th Street Station for New York in 65 minutes.

Philadelphia Climate

Humid continental climate on the Delaware River. Winters (December–March) are cold (−2 to 5°C) with snow and ice. Philadelphia sits in the I-95 "snow corridor" and receives significant nor'easter snowfall several times per winter. PHL has solid de-icing capacity, but major storms cause multi-hour and multi-day disruptions.

Summers are hot and humid (28–34°C) with afternoon thunderstorms that cause frequent delays June through August. Spring and fall are transitional with variable conditions. Fog along the Delaware is occasional in fall and early winter mornings.
